Plumbing in North Hollywood

North Hollywood plumbing reflects a distinct housing mix: pre-war single-family homes around Camellia Avenue and Magnolia Park (1925–1945), 1940s–1960s ranch tract homes, dense mid-rise apartment buildings along Lankershim and Magnolia, and post-2010 mixed-use redevelopment in the NoHo Arts District. The mix matters for plumbing diagnosis. Pre-war NoHo homes typically have cast iron drain stacks and either original copper or partial galvanized supply lines that are 80–95 years old. The 1950s–1970s tract homes were built on slab with copper supply, much of which has reached pinhole-leak age. The mid-rise apartment buildings generate a completely different set of plumbing calls than single-family — shared kitchen and bathroom stacks, common-area water heating, and shared lateral runs. North Hollywood also runs hard water, 14–18 grains per gallon from the LADWP San Fernando Valley supply.

Emergency Plumbing Patterns Specific to North Hollywood

North Hollywood emergencies cluster by housing type. Single-family pre-war homes around Camellia and Magnolia Park most often call for slab leaks (copper run in slab during 1950s rebuilds), galvanized supply line bursts, and main sewer backups. The dense mid-rise apartment buildings along Lankershim and Magnolia generate stack leaks, T&P relief discharges from aging water heaters, and shared-lateral clogs. Hard water from LADWP also causes sudden tankless shutdowns when scale crosses the heat-exchanger threshold — usually a 2 AM no-hot-water emergency that requires descaling rather than parts replacement.

What to Expect on a Emergency Plumber Call in North Hollywood

Recent NoHo emergency: a 1948 single-family home on Camellia Avenue called at 1 AM with water spraying from a wall in the laundry room. Galvanized supply line had burst behind drywall — visible rust streaks confirmed long-term internal corrosion. Capped at the meter overnight, returned at 7 AM, replaced the failed section with PEX, drywall to prep state. Total emergency: $720; section repair next day: $480. Recommended whole-house repipe quote: $9,800–$11,500.
